Parmakanthion profundum

Parmakanthion profundum is the scientific name of a group of Lamiinae -also called lamiines or flat-faced longhorned beetles-


Parmakanthion profundum Heffern & Santos-Silva, 2022

Heffern, D.J. & Santos-Silva, A. are the authors of the original taxon.

The type specimen used for original description is cited from Honduras.

Parmakanthion profundum Heffern & Santos-Silva, 2022 is the full name of the group-species in the taxonomic classification system.

The species is combined with the Parmakanthion genus ranked in the Parmenini tribe of Lamiinae.
